View of a suburb in Winnetka. Winnetka (/ w ɪ ˈ n ɛ t k ə /) is a neighborhood in the west-central San Fernando Valley in the city of Los Angeles. It is an ethnically diverse area, both for the city and for Los Angeles County, with a relatively large percentage of Hispanic and Asian people. Winnetka was founded in 1922 as a small farming ...
